Title: Estimating Eligible Cost | |
Abstract: This rule would revise 44 CFR part 206, subpart H, to reflect changes in the way FEMA estimates the cost of repairing, restoring, reconstructing, or replacing a facility consistent with industry practices and in awarding Federal large project grants based on the application of floor and ceiling thresholds. This rule reflects the changes needed to put the statutorily mandated cost-estimating procedures in section 405(e) of the Robert T. Stafford Disaster Relief and Emergency Assistance Act into effect. | |
